Abstract

The utility model discloses a kind of coordinated type powder output slot mechanism being located between bean milling device and extraction equipment, it is characterised in that:Including press-powder head, track support, crank rod assembly and telescopic powder feeding assembly;There is a corresponding net cup below the press-powder head;The press-powder head is slideable to be arranged on the track support;The crank rod assembly connects the press-powder head, for driving the press-powder head to be slided along the track support;The telescopic powder feeding assembly correspondence is arranged on above the side of the net cup, and with shift fork linkage unit between the press-powder head.The utility model has the advantages that, using the telescopic powder feeding assembly with sideboard the card powder of powder mouth internal residual can be avoided to continue to fall out, while the steam during avoiding coffee extracted is hardened into going out inside powder mouth and bean milling device to cause coffee powder to make moist.

Embodiment
Feature of the present utility model and other correlated characteristics are made further specifically by embodiment below in conjunction with accompanying drawing It is bright, in order to the understanding of technical staff of the same trade:
Mark 1-16 is respectively in such as Fig. 1-2, figure:Press-powder first 1, track support 2, crank rod assembly 3, powder supply group Part 4, net cup 5, shift fork linkage unit 6, crank 7, connecting rod 8, handle 9, the first vertical track 10, the second inclined plane the 11, the 3rd Vertical track 12, go out powder mouth 13, telescopic chute 14, bean milling device 15, sideboard 16.
Embodiment:As shown in Figure 1, 2, the present embodiment is specifically related to a kind of connection being located between bean milling device and extraction equipment Dynamic formula powder output slot mechanism, the ground coffee that the mechanism is used to grind coffee bean bean milling device is delivered in coffee extractor;This The coordinated type powder output slot mechanism of embodiment includes press-powder first 1, track support 2, crank rod assembly 3 and the supply of telescopic powder Component 4;First 1 lower section of press-powder has a corresponding net cup 5;Net cup 5 belongs to coffee extractor, in extraction process Middle receiving coffee powder;Track support 2 is vertically set, and press-powder first 1 is slideable to be arranged on track support 2;Crank Link assembly 3 connects press-powder first 1, for driving press-powder first 1 to be slided along track support 2;The telescopic correspondence of powder feeding assembly 4 is pacified Above the side of net cup 5, and with shift fork linkage unit 6 between press-powder first 1.
As depicted in figs. 1 and 2, the number of track support 2 is two, and two track supports 2 are symmetricly set on the two of press-powder first 1 Side;In the present embodiment, track support 2 is the groove for the shell inner surface for being opened in coffee extractor, the both sides of press-powder first 1 With the projection being engaged with track support 2(Do not drawn in figure), the projection is fastened on inside track support 2, and can edge Track support 2 is slided.Crank rod assembly 3 includes crank 7 and connecting rod 8, and crank 7 is connected with handle 9;The first end hinge of crank 7 The housing of the coffee extractor is connected on, and is fixedly connected with leader 9;Second end of crank 7 is articulated with the first of connecting rod 8 End, two ends of connecting rod 8 are articulated with the top of press-powder first 1.By swing handle 9, crank rod assembly 3 can eastern first 1 edge of press-powder in road Track support 2 is slided.
As depicted in figs. 1 and 2, track support 2 from bottom to top successively by the first vertical track 10, the second inclined plane 11 with And the 3rd vertical track 12 constitute, wherein, the first vertical track 10 makes press-powder first 1 and net cup 5 be in same axis, and second tilts The vertical track 12 of track 11 and the 3rd makes the axis of the first 1 deviation net cup 5 of press-powder.
As depicted in figs. 1 and 2, telescopic powder feeding assembly 4 includes powder mouth 13 and telescopic chute 14;Go out powder mouth 13 First end is connected to bean milling device 15, and the movable of telescopic chute 14 is located at the second end of powder mouth 13;Shift fork linkage unit 6 is connected Between press-powder first 1 and telescopic chute 14, for driving telescopic chute 14 with the motion synchronization telescope of press-powder first 1.When press-powder first 1 rises When, telescopic chute 14 is from going out in powder mouth 13 to stretch out, so that coffee powder is dropped downward into inside net cup 5.Go out the leading section shell of powder mouth 13 It is hinged on body and is provided with a turnover sideboard 16;When telescopic chute 14 is from when going out stretching in powder mouth 13, go out powder mouth 13 by work The dynamic jack-up of baffle plate 16;In sideboard 16 and go out between the leading section of powder mouth 13 torsion being provided with for driving sideboard 16 to close Square spring;When telescopic chute 14 shrinks, torsion spring driving sideboard 16 downwardly turns over closure;Sideboard 16 can after closing So that the outlet for going out powder mouth 13 to be blocked completely, it is to avoid the card powder for going out the internal residual of powder mouth 13 continues to fall, while avoiding coffee Steam in extraction process is hardened into going out inside powder mouth and bean milling device to cause coffee powder to make moist.
As depicted in figs. 1 and 2, in the coordinated type powder output slot mechanism course of work of the present embodiment, first to inside net cup 5 Coffee powder is loaded, is concretely comprised the following steps:Swing handle 9, the driving press-powder head of crank rod assembly 3 is moved upwards;Now shift fork joins Dynamic component 6 drives telescopic chute 14 from going out stretching in powder mouth 13, and simultaneous retractable groove 14 is by the upward jack-up of sideboard 16(Such as Fig. 1 institutes Show);Subsequent coffee powder is dropped downward into inside net cup 5 via powder mouth 13, telescopic chute 14 is gone out.
After coffee powder filling is finished, press-powder first 1 is pressed downward inside networking cup 5, concretely comprised the following steps:Swing handle 9, it is bent The driving press-powder first 1 of handle link assembly 3 moves downwardly to the first vertical track 10;In order to avoid telescopic powder feeding assembly 4 hinders Hinder press-powder first 1, during press-powder first 1 declines, the driving telescopic chute 14 of shift fork linkage unit 6 enters contraction state with press-powder first 1; Sideboard 16 also downwardly turns over closure in the presence of torsion spring during telescopic chute 14 is retracted out powder mouth 13, blocks out The outlet of powder mouth 13;When press-powder first 1 drops to minimum point(As shown in Figure 2)Afterwards, you can use the coffee in the first 1 pair of net cup 5 of press-powder Coffee powder is extracted.
The advantage of the present embodiment is:(1)Using integrated design, coffee bean bean milling device and extraction equipment are connected to one Rise, the conveying of coffee powder can be only completed by swing handle;(2)Using the telescopic formula powder supply with sideboard Component 4 can avoid out the card powder of the internal residual of powder mouth 13 from continuing to fall, while the steam during avoiding coffee extracted enters Enter out that to cause coffee powder to make moist inside powder mouth and bean milling device hardened.
